Chapter 7: Summon Ghosts

“I really don’t know how a newcomer like you came up with this method.”

Human thinking has limitations. This method might be conceivable for passengers who have experienced many platform missions, but the one proposing it now is a newcomer who just got on the train and is participating in a platform mission for the first time.

This is the reason Jiang Yingzhi felt shocked about it.

But after Lu Jinzhao proposed this suggestion, she pondered for a moment and then approved her method.

Although this method sounds somewhat too horrifying and against common sense, the current situation leaves them no choice but to treat a dead horse as if it were alive.

Lu Jinzhao smiled without answering her remark, instead asking: “After the surgery, you definitely won’t be able to help me with anything else, so my request is that you protect me during my cornea replacement surgery. If you encounter any abnormalities, you must do your utmost to help me. Can you do that?”

“No problem.”

Jiang Yingzhi affirmed, then added as if remembering something: “I didn’t tell you newcomers earlier because I thought it wouldn’t be needed for the time being, but now it fits perfectly.”

“During the surgery, you can request the doctor to do it roughly but quickly. Don’t worry about leaving any hidden issues, because”

“all injuries sustained in the platform mission can be healed after returning to the train using the money on the train ticket.”

“As long as you have one breath left, you can be saved.”

Lu Jinzhao blinked lightly upon hearing this. So that’s why this money is called lifesaving money?

“However, note that…” Jiang Yingzhi wasn’t finished.

“No matter what, before boarding the train, never let the money on the train ticket reach zero, or else you will lose the qualification to board the train!”

Not boarding the train in the real world equals death.

Not returning to the train in time inside the platform means being stuck forever in the platform world.

No passenger who stayed inside the platform has ever been heard to return alive to the real world!

“I understand.”

After discussing with Jiang Yingzhi, the two parted ways. Lu Jinzhao continued following the group, waiting for the surgery time, while Jiang Yingzhi went to arrange her own “pregnancy” surgery.

The subsequent see a ghost missions continued to carry a weird atmosphere laced with unease.

In the black cat hide-and-seek mission, since there was only one player, he could only play by himself with the black cat.

He must hide first and let the black cat search for him. Before the black cat finds him, he cannot reveal himself or leave on his own.

According to the book’s description, at this moment, he was hiding behind the ghost.

Not following the rules and leaving on his own before being found would result in the ghost finding him.

But after hide-and-seek began, the black cat encountered some mishap during the search. By the time other players saw it, it had already become a corpse.

With no cat to search, what should the hider do?

He fell into a puzzle extremely similar to Lin Shuyue’s, while the others didn’t even know where he was hiding and no one was willing to look for him.

The other missions also encountered extremely similar difficult problems. But for Lu Jinzhao, the biggest common point among them, and the one she cared about most, was just one thing:

—She had never seen the “ghost” once from beginning to end.

Every time, it was only companions falling into a terrifying situation, but the ghost causing that situation had never appeared.

Does it really exist?

It probably does; otherwise, how to explain those supernatural phenomena?

But why has the ghost never truly shown itself once?

Not even a shadow!

Lu Jinzhao didn’t understand. Perhaps only Cen Duo, who might have really seen a ghost, could comprehend a bit, but Lu Jinzhao really didn’t want to get close to her.

Even standing a little closer to her made her brain buzz, as if her instinct was warning her: stay away from this off woman!

Lu Jinzhao could only suppress this doubt for now. Perhaps after transplanting the dead person’s cornea and being able to “see a ghost,” she would understand.

Soon, the surgery time arrived. After going through successive see a ghost missions, the original 9-person team had only 5 left after Lu Jinzhao and Jiang Yingzhi left, among whom four had not yet completed see a ghost missions.

More than half the time had passed, and the atmosphere of anxiety and unease grew heavier. The remaining four also decided to split up.

Cen Duo decided to accompany the person who drew number 10 to complete the ultimate see a ghost method, while Zhou Wenbo teamed up with another to complete crossroads bowl-tapping and midnight hair-combing.

Before leaving, Lu Jinzhao learned about their groupings. But when she heard Cen Duo was accompanying to complete the number 10 mission, a strange feeling involuntarily rose in her heart.

She always felt that Cen Duo’s purpose was definitely not simple companionship or help.

But she had no standing or evidence to warn the other, so she could only hope the other was smart enough to notice Cen Duo’s subtle weirdness.

Upon arriving at the clinic, Jiang Yingzhi was already waiting. Soon, Lu Jinzhao’s surgery began.

Local anesthesia completed, Lu Jinzhao lay on the operating table.

Jiang Yingzhi stood beside the operating table, vigilantly watching the surroundings to prevent possible accidents.

The surgery environment was somewhat crude, but the instruments were comprehensive. Lu Jinzhao’s eyes were held open with an eyelid speculum, preventing her from blinking or seeing the surgery details.

The surgery began.

The local anesthesia kept her thinking clear, with only her eyes feeling no pain and reduced clarity.

She clearly knew something was operating on her eyeball but could only see blurry shadows, so her heart didn’t produce much fear.

As the surgery progressed, Lu Jinzhao noticed her vision becoming blurry—probably the doctor handling her cornea. This process lasted a while and wouldn’t recover immediately after surgery.

It should be like this.

Lu Jinzhao couldn’t quite remember how much time had passed. She only knew that in the moment she realized, her view had become extremely clear.

As if she hadn’t been anesthetized at all, or undergone cornea surgery.

But how could that be?

She could now clearly see the appearance of the instruments above!

Why was this happening?

Wasn’t the surgery still ongoing?

She tried to move her eyeballs but couldn’t. She was still under anesthesia, yet her line of sight was extremely clear.

Weirdness.

This was definitely not normal.

The surgery hadn’t ended, so Lu Jinzhao didn’t dare act rashly. However, as it continued, she felt the temperature in the operating room seeming to drop bit by bit.

The hairs on her arms had quietly stood up at some point, like a danger warning.

The shadowless lamp occupied most of her line of sight, beside which were the busy doctor and nurse doing the surgery. But…

There was also a motionless shadow figure standing beside the operating table. What was that?

"Do you believe there are ghosts in this world?" The roommate's final question before jumping off the building forced Lu Jinzhao into an unspeakable terror loop. Bloodstained parchment, a black train ticket engraved with her name, and living people vanishing into thin air— Storage locker No. 504 at Yuncheng Train Station became her gateway to death. When the train of weirdness stopped in front of Lu Jinzhao, she had only one choice. "If you don't board, it's a dead end." The parchment gripped in her hand gave her the warning. In order to survive, Lu Jinzhao boarded this train bound for hell, stepping to the edge of life and death.
